Q: Is 1,723,624 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,723,624 is a composite number.

Why is 1,723,624 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,723,624 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 8 14 28 49 56 98 196 392 4,397 8,794 17,588 30,779 35,176 61,558 123,116 215,453 246,232 430,906 861,812 and 1,723,624, with no remainder.

Since 1,723,624 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,723,624, it is a composite number.
